Subject: Scheduled key rotation for the Vaultspin plugin API

Hello plugin authors,

As part of our quarterly rotation policy, Vaultspin will retire the current plugin-gateway credentials at the end of this month. All plugins calling the Vaultspin rotation endpoints must switch to the new credential before then; the old one will stop authenticating after the cutoff and requests will return a 401. No other API changes accompany this rotation. For the transition period, both keys are accepted. The replacement key is below.

gateway credential: kto23_LX9A4ys6i4nzHtpOLNLodKK

Leadership Review Briefing — Ostrello Pilot Churn

For the finance team: churn in the Ostrello pilot reached 11% this quarter, above the 7% threshold set at launch. Departing accounts were mainly mid-tier subscribers citing integration delays. Revenue impact is roughly offset by upsells in the retained base, so net pilot income is flat. Corrective actions include a simplified onboarding flow and revised support rota. Figures are in the appendix. Please review the confidential note appended below before the meeting.

management briefing: Project Ulavan slips by two quarters because of the staffing delay.

ALERT: plumage-render — template p95 latency breach. Plumage template rendering exceeded 800ms p95 for 15 minutes on the Mossbay cluster. Likely cause: unbounded partial includes in newsletter templates. New team members: do not restart renderers manually; drain via the scheduler. Check cache hit rate first. Full diagnosis steps are on the internal runbook page below.

wiki page, tahaf-tajog: https://jira.ordindyn.corp/pipeline